Anila Sinha Foundation (ASF) Announces an Unforgettable Evening of Romeo and Juliet. Celebrating 400 Hundred years of Shakespeares Work
An unforgettable evening of spellbinding performances to commemorate 400 years of Shakespeares work! Anila Sinha Foundation (ASF) is proud to present Shakespeares Romeo and Juliet in a Kathak ballet form on Sunday July 10th, 2016 at McAninch Arts Center at College of DuPage, Glen Ellyn, IL 60137. Pt. Birju Maharaj and Ms. Saswati Sen, the creators of this unique and innovative idea, will be on stage with their troupe of more than 30 top notch performers from India, for this one of a kind enchanting and enlightening performance. Only one show has been planned for Chicago. For the first time this tale has been adapted and presented in the Indian classical dance Kathak style. Its original music score has been composed by Pt. Birju Maharaj in collaboration with Jazz maestro Louis Banks. The performance is choreographed by internationally acclaimed Kathak artist Saswati Sen; and stage lights and special effects are created by internationally renowned Dinesh Poddar. This eternal love saga has stirred millions of hearts for centuries and has inspired poets, musicians and creative artistes from all over the world to recount the passion and pathos inherent in the story. As an added value and to set the mood for the main even Romeo and Juliet, we plan to begin the evening with a unique and memorable Kathak and Tabla performance by world renowned Kathak Maestro Padma Vibhushan (India's 2nd highest civilian award) Pandit Birju Maharaj and Tabla Maestro Pandit Swapan Chaudhuri. Romeo and Juliet not only celebrates the history, it also showcases the beauty of Kathak as it stretches its wings and covers new horizons. The multi-talented Pandit Birju Maharaj has won many accolades, including Padma Vibhushan in 1986, Sangeet Natak Akademi Award and the Kalidas Samman. He won the Filmfare award for best Choreography for the song 'Mohe rang do laal' from 'Bajirao Mastani' in 2016 and the National Film Award for Best Choreography: Vishwaroopam 2012. Pandit Swapan Chaudhuri is known all over the world for his purity of sound, depth of knowledge, rhythmic creativity, and dedication to teaching the art of Tabla. He is considered one of the greatest living musicians and tabla virtuosos of our time. Anila Sinha Foundation, a not for profit organization, was established in memory of Mrs. Anila Sinha, a staunch promoter of Kathak Dance and Music. Since its inception in 1999 ASF has presented a number of performances every year to promote the most popular dance form of north India, Kathak, with its associated music and stagecraft.
